Adrian Vande Merwe

January 14, 1959 - March 5, 2023

Adrian J. Vande Merwe was born January 14, 1959 in Bountiful, Utah. He attended Viewmont High School, the University of Utah and dental school at the University of the Pacific. He practiced dentistry in Bountiful for 36 years. He was a beloved dentist in Davis County because of his compassion, humor and honesty. He never tried to sell a service that was not needed and made many house-calls to relieve pain. His staff were treated like family. He had a brilliant mind and was an avid reader. He appreciated architecture, designing a “Frank Lloyd Wright” style home in Mueller Park Canyon and was also a gifted artist. When asked why he became a dentist rather than study art or architecture, he answered, “I liked helping people in their time of need.” Adrian married the love of his life, Jamie Swanson on March 11th 1995. Their daughter, Holland, was born in November of 1999. They loved traveling together. Adrian and Jamie rarely missed one of Holland’s volleyball matches or softball games, no matter where it was played. Adrian also enjoyed bicycling, sailing and hiking - although he could never keep up with Jamie (who can?). He was very generous, kind, compassionate, and 100% honest. He always advocated for those who faced discrimination and attended many Pride parades. Most of all, Adrian was an amazing husband and father. One of the highlights of his life was to be able to attend Holland’s wedding while fighting the most aggressive type of brain cancer, glioblastoma. Adrian is survived by his wife, Jamie, daughter, Holland, son-in-law, Ethan, Mother, Donna and siblings Joe (Kari), Audrey (Greg), Dave (Kim) and Rob (Liz) and his dog, Sullivan. He is preceded in death by his father, Joe and his in-laws, Hank and Doris Swanson, and many dogs. He passed away on March 5th 2023 at Creekside Senior Living, in the room next to his mother.
